Hall of Fame Inductees, Class of 2013 Jenny Heidt, Westminster Schools In her time at Pace and Westminster, Jenny Heidt has helped increase the prestige and quality of policy debate in the state of Georgia. On the National circuit, teams coached by Jenny have won the National Tournament of Champions 5 times, the Baker Award 3 times, and a number of Georgia State Championships. In 2012, Jenny was inducted in the National Tournament of Champions Hall of Fame for Coaches. In addition to her success on the local and national circuit, she has done a great deal to support the development of debate in Georgia. First, she hosts the first novice debate tournament of the year every year. At this tournament, she helps promote a great educational environment that helps introduce and retain students in the activity. She also provides a beginner workshop for students and coaches. Second, she has been a contributor to the novice evidence packet produced for policy debate. Third, she has provided a number of wonderful power points and resources to help coaches teach novice debaters. Finally, she has been very supportive and instrumental in the development of the middle school debate circuit. Steven Stein, Chattahoochee High School Steve Stein coached at Chattahoochee from 1999 to 2004, where he began a tradition of excellence in policy debate in a community. Steve helped begin several educational institutions in the Atlanta area before departing to the Boston Urban Debate League. In 2002, Steve, alongside Lisa Willoughby of Grady, created the GFCA 1st & 2nd Year State Championships to honor young debaters for their achievements. Along with this tournament, Steve co-founded the Atlanta Urban Middle School Debate League. This league continues to feed strong middle school debaters into high school programs today. Not only did Steve help the state and community but he built Chattahoochee High School into a local and national powerhouse. He qualified six teams to the Tournament of Champions, and won two Varsity State championships, 3 JV State Championships, and 3 Novice State Championships. Steve was the first coach to ever win all three levels of Policy Debate in the same year back to back. Bill Swafford, Lee County High School Bill Swafford certainly has enough years of service. For 44 years, Bill Swafford has coached programs all over the United States, including Colorado, Kentucky, Indiana, and Georgia. Bill began in Georgia coaching Albany High School, where he was able to coach to his oldest son to many successful tournaments. He later moved to Lee County High School, where he was able to achieve many successes including the 2013 GFCA Varsity Congressional Debate State Championship, and many NFL, NCFL and TOC qualifiers in speech. It can be said that Bill Swafford is the reason why debate still exists today in the Albany area. One of his former students has this to say, Aside from my father, no other man has had such a significant impact in my life as Mr. Swafford. He has worked with me for countless hours after school, on weekends, and even over multiple summer breaks. Without his help and critiques, I would be nowhere near the public speaker I am today. Instead, I would still be the stumbling and bumbling freshman who had a propensity to talk too much. For having such an impact, I can never thank him enough. And even though he s retiring this year, he still will remain committed to coaching the team and, hopefully, continuing to lead them to more victories across the state and country.

Georgia Forensic Coaches Association Schools of Excellence Recipients The Schools of Excellence Awards are given to the school in each size classification who qualified the most number of students to the State Championships. Each award is named after a GFCA Hall of Fame coach. This tradition was started in 2011 by Claude Robinson of Lincoln County High School. Congratulations to the winners! Georgia Forensic Coaches Association N. Bruce Rogers President s Cup The N. Bruce Roger s Presidents Cup is a traveling Trophy Award given to the school with the highest number of rounds at the State Tournament. Each year your school s total number of rounds rolls over to the next year. A school can only win the trophy once in five years. The GFCA State Championship Historical Archive Since 2002, the GFCA has awarded 155 State Championships. Every year, 31 additional State Champions are added. The concept of a state championship awarded by the coaches association originated from Steve Stein, former coach at Chattahoochee High School, and Lisa Willoughby, coach at Henry W. Grady High School.
